Finding the Radius of a Circle from a Chord

Medium Geometry And Measurement Circles

In a circle, a chord measures 10 cm and is 6 cm away from the center of the circle. What is the radius of the circle?

To find the radius of the circle given a chord, we can use the relationship that if a perpendicular line is drawn from the center of the circle to the chord, it bisects the chord. Let's denote:

- $r$: the radius of the circle

- $d$: the distance from the center to the chord (6 cm)

- $c$: half the length of the chord (5 cm)

Using the Pythagorean theorem, we can establish the equation:

$$r^2 = d^2 + c^2$$
